requests库的小技巧

#coding:utf-8
import requests


# url = 'http://www.baidu.com'
# response = requests.get(url)
# print (response.cookies)
# print (type(response.cookies))

# 将cookjar转换成字典格式的cookies

# dict_cookies = requests.utils.dict_from_cookiejar(response.cookies)
# print (dict_cookies)
# print (type(dict_cookies))

# jar_cookies = requests.utils.cookiejar_from_dict(dict_cookies)
# print (jar_cookies)
# print (type(jar_cookies))

######################################关闭ssl认证
# CA认证是老外搞得,我们自己有一套,但是老外不承认,我们请求时就关闭ca认证,verify=False
# url = 'https://www.12306.cn/mormhweb/'
# try:
#     response = requests.get(url)
# except:
#     response = requests.get(url, verify=False)
# print (response.content)


######################################超时
# url = 'http://www.youtube.com'
#
# response = requests.get(url, timeout=3)

# 断言
# 判断语句是否为真:为真,过;不为真,抛出异常
# assert response.status_code == 200

  

posted @ 2018-01-18 00:29  安迪9468  阅读(115)  评论(0编辑  收藏  举报